I would not worry about the test results. They are used to test the school, not your child. The idea is to test all the kids in the school at 7 and again at 11, then see how much 'value' the school has added. From the school's point of view, they want low scores at 7 but high scores at 11, to show that they have added a lot of value. Whatever the outcome, it's not going to affect your kid, at least not the age 7 score. Do the school a favour, and don't coach him!
I agree- but with one proviso. If your child is doing key stage 2 tests they are often used in setting classes so if their performance is a bit variable then it can be important what level they get, as if they are borderline to get into a higher set, of course the figures will be used. Having said that, it is really difficult to make a whole levels difference to them and most schools are obsessing about these tests like mad anyway, so you are likely to make the kids feel anxious about them. The English test is a really poor test imo as it only allows certain answers, when other answers are correct- English being that kind of subject- but they want to make it easy to mark.0 -

Warning - These are past papers - sounds obvious but...
Whilst some schools use these as mocks, the biggest impact on their usefulness affects the Shakespeare paper. Macbeth - previously the favoured text of most schools - has now been dropped by QCA. Most schools have moved on to 'The Tempest' or 'Much Ado'
QCA in its wisdom, publishes 'set scenes' for students to study, however, these tend to be changed just about every year (which means lots of work for English teachers - they never change 'the heart' in Science do they?!?) As a consequence, past papers will rarely be useful if they relate to the Shakespeare examination.
